Overview
This opportunity entails developing the value chain for the Aluminium downstream business, to develop the automotive value chain.
Cast wheels are formed by pouring molten Aluminium into a mold and machining the bolt-holes and flanges into spec. Cast wheels have a uniform grain, where the molecules sit on top of each other and are held together by mechanical adhesion. Most cast wheels use A-356 Aluminium, which is only about 60% as strong as the 500 or 6000-series alloys used for forged wheels.
Aluminium Alloy Wheel is made by Aluminium alloy. The Aluminium alloy wheel usually has better heat conduction and the weight is also lighter than the steel wheel
